Professor Sun Jung Myung's research lab focuses on translational biomedical research, particularly in the role of Wnt signaling in fibrotic diseases such as hepatic, pulmonary, and renal fibrosis. The lab also investigates clinical education innovations, including online medical education during public health crises and the assessment of clinical reasoning through OSCEs. Additionally, the lab explores the psychological and lifestyle impacts of pandemics on medical students using network-based analytical approaches. Their work bridges molecular mechanisms of disease with medical education and mental health research.

Wnt signaling was implicated in pulmonary and renal fibrosis. Since Wnt activity is enhanced in liver cirrhosis, Wnt signaling may also participate in hepatic fibrogenesis. Thus, we determined if Wnt signaling modulates hepatic stellate cell (HSC) activation and survival. Wnt3A treatment significantly activated human HSCs, while this was inhibited in secreted frizzled-related protein 1 (sFRP1) overexpressing cells. An education program for disclosing medical errors was helpful in improving confidence in medical error disclosure. Extending the program to more diverse scenarios and a more diverse group of physicians is needed.
OSCE score from patient encounters did not reflect the clinical reasoning abilities of the medical students in this study. The evaluation of medical students' clinical reasoning abilities through OSCE should be strengthened.
The current COVID-19 pandemic have affected our daily lifestyle, pressed us with fear of infection, and thereby changed life satisfaction and mental health. The current study investigated influencing cascade of changes during the COVID-19 among the lifestyle, personal attitudes, and life (dis)satisfaction for medical students, using network-based approaches.
